dc.description.abstract | That post-mortem AMPK activity level is highly sensitive to temperature and not at in vitro changes in glycogen concentration. Their results suggest that that normal levels of pre-mortem muscle glycogen and an adequate cooling managing of carcasses are relevant to let an efficient glycogenolytic/glycolytic flow required for lactate accumulation and pH decline, trough of post-mortem AMPK signalling pathway. | vi |
